Top-Rated Coding Sites Used by Students in Armenia

Learn coding with freeCodeCamp

1. freeCodeCamp

Best for: beginners, self-learners

Price: Free

Pros: Completely free, certifications, huge community, project-based

Cons: Self-paced, no live mentorship

Learn coding with Codecademy

2. Codecademy

Best for: beginners wanting guided lessons

Price: Free basic, Pro $19.99/mo

Pros: Interactive, great for basics, certificates

Cons: Limited free content, no deep projects

Learn coding with The Odin Project

3. The Odin Project

Best for: serious career switchers

Price: Free

Pros: Project-heavy, open-source, community support

Cons: No live classes, steep learning curve

Learn coding with Udemy

4. Udemy

Best for: budget learners wanting courses

Price: $10–$20 per course (sales)

Pros: Lifetime access, huge selection

Cons: Quality varies, no mentorship

Learn coding with Code.org

5. Code.org

Best for: children learning coding

Price: Free

Pros: Fun games, Hour of Code, teacher resources

Cons: Basic, not for advanced learners
